Output 21cf07d5a4384cbed1233d9d46a4294d47d4c2ab27eb05f977c12e6f5962e336:1

value
28821339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0966dd321ebb2fcbc88d0f627bc7abd9379943cf OP_EQUAL
address
32YjEPYLaCQhL7G5gvia9Kj5NJextpcKV3
transaction
21cf07d5a4384cbed1233d9d46a4294d47d4c2ab27eb05f977c12e6f5962e336
spent
true